TVS (Transient Voltage Suppressor) Diodes are an essential component for overvoltage protection of sensitive electronics. The PGSMAJ8.0AHM2G is one type of TVS Diode which is designed specifically to provide effective protection up to 8.0A of peak pulse current. TVS Diodes have become increasingly popular within a wide range of applications, as they are simple to install and provide both cost-effective and reliable overvoltage protection.

TVS Diodes have become an invaluable safety device which is able to protect power supplies, telecommunications, computers and many other applications from overvoltage transients.
